Next summer, you can use your TV subscriptions abroad

The Ministry of Culture wants Norwegians who subscribe to Netflix, TV 2 Sumo and HBO, to also be able to watch television when traveling abroad.
The reason is that the EU has decided that subscribers of portable online content services can also access these services on temporary stays outside of their countries of residence.
On July 6, it was decided to take the so-called Portability Regulation, which came into force in the EU in April of this year, into the EEA Agreement.
